Label Text:The intersection between fashion and streamlined dancewear reached its apogee in New York City during the 1970s. The creator who best expressed this phenomenon was Bonnie August, design director of Danskin, Inc., then the largest dancewear manufacturer in America. August wisely appropriated select elements from the ballerina’s class and rehearsal wardrobe when designing her easily wearable, day-to-evening separates. The company’s catchy slogan—“Danskin, not just for dancing”—perfectly described the dresses and separates that moved seamlessly from the ballet studio to the disco to the street.
